Migration step 4 — Corvid Registry

Point all producers at the new Corvid schema registry before decommissioning the legacy Pellat endpoint. Register every subject first; the new instance enforces backward compatibility by default. Run the verifier script, confirm zero unregistered subjects, then flip the producer flag. Do not migrate consumers until producers report clean for 24 hours. Rollback: flip the flag back; legacy stays warm for two weeks. The registry's active configuration is reproduced below.

config for tagep-yajef:
ulawyn:
  log_level: error
  metrics_host: metrics.ulawyn.lumiclabs.internal
  pin: 0564
  pool_size: 32

Build Provenance: Stocktally Reconciliation Job

For the weekly sync: the Stocktally inventory reconciliation job now ships with signed provenance metadata. Each nightly run records the source commit, the builder image digest, and the warehouse snapshot it consumed. Discrepancy reports are only trusted if provenance verification passes. The token for the most recent verified run appears below.

pipeline stamp: htk31_f769b577b3028a4e9958e5bb8d1259a

Welcome to the Lanternfall perf team. Our GPU memory profiling is handled by Gristmill, a sampling agent that attaches to render workers and streams allocation snapshots to the Hearthview dashboard. Install the agent from the internal package mirror, then run gristmill init in your workspace to generate a local config. The agent authenticates to the ingest endpoint with a contractor-scoped credential, which expires every 90 days. Use the key provided just below to get started.

service key, fawip-bajef: kto11_Qt5wZK9vdNC

**Ticket: Rate-limit config drift on Gatewright internal API gateway**

We discovered that the staging and production clusters of Gatewright have diverged on rate-limiting settings. Staging was hand-edited during the Pellam incident in March and never reconciled, so burst allowances differ by an order of magnitude. Future maintainers: treat the deployment manifest as the single source of truth and never patch nodes directly. For clarity, the values currently authoritative for production are recorded below.

config for haweg-bagag:
[kasath]
host = kasath.qirvancorp.internal
user = kasath_svc
database = kasath_prod